A leggy black and white waterbird with contrasting black back/wings with white underparts, long pink legs, thin black bill, white head/neck
makes it unmistakble with a distictive call. Prefers freshwater marshes and paddyfield, occasionably small numbers are found at coastal mudflats.

It is common throughout Seberang Perai with the local population increasing for reasons not completely clear. Flocks of up to thousand plus can be seen at the Permatang Pauh – Permatang Nibong Paddyfields.
